richyrich01 wrote:
23 Sep 2019 19:29
I am pretty certain you are right that it is the traffic density that's causing it mate
please let me say that your sentence is wrong. I am the author of the traffic mod in cause. believe me, I have tested and compared v1.34 and v1.35 and my conclusion is only one: from 1.35 the game is more problematic with traffic density and Dx11 implementation might be the cause (or a hidden bug that leads to memory leak). after many weeks of testing and crashes, me and other users realized that game crashes inevitably with increased traffic density (not neceesarily with my traffic mod) and only when more trafifc packs were used. I left my game playing alone only with my mod, for one hour and I had no crashes (this was one of the many tests I performed in 1.35).

the solution was to make use of the memory parameters kindly offered by SCS and about which you can read here: https://forum.scssoft.com/viewtopic.php?f=41&t=261451
using these codes, and only 8 Gb of RAM I was able to load and drive with all jazzycat traffic packs except for painted trucks. later I upgraded to 16 Gb of RAM and succesfully installed other trafifc packs (extra trailers from trailer packs and doubles, more cars, etc). however it;s highly recommended to have more than 8Gb of RAM, especially after 1.35 update if using higher density, extra traffic packs and extra maps because the files seems to be managed differently in 1.35, everything seems to be stored in RAM longer, or cache is not removed, no idea because I am not a programmer, but something has been definitely changed.

let me say also that increasing g_traffic is not going to offer a stable game experience, this is not even supported by scs, it's more FPS demanding and you are losing realism since g_traffic increases traffic where there is less traffic with no logic about less traffic at night time, more traffic at rush hours, less traffic on local roads, etc
you can read more about what a traffic density mod can do on my thread on scs forum https://forum.scssoft.com/viewtopic.php?t=249660

at the end my traffic mod is called "Real Traffic Density" and it brings on roads the amount of vehicles that it should, not more, not less and it will always be FPS friendly as long as you have at least an average PC and reasonable traffic packs. there are other traffic mods with less traffic that some say are better. Better because weak PCs will perform of course better with less traffic, there is no magic in this :lol: , at the end people are free to test and decide, I can only recommend to stop using g_traffic
